Not pricey and consistent

Average Rating
60

I have eaten at this restaurant numerous times for breakfast, lunch and dinner it's very consistent as the food goes. They also have some homemade desserts and some of the other food items are homemade like I said they are very consistent. A good little local restaurant that serves consistent food that's not too pricey we will definitely go back.

Great food and plenty of it

Average Rating
100

I love going to Water's Edge Cafe. They have very good food, the portions are large (some days my husband and I split an entree) and their desserts are made from scratch. Breakfast

Average Rating
80

This is a solid little local restaurant. The afternoon menu focuses on Louisiana style foods. The morning menu is breakfast comfort food and is very tasty. Worth the stop if you are in Little Elm
